Passbook: различия между версиями

Материал из Центр поддержки системы бронировании
Перейти к навигации Перейти к поиску
(Скачать passbook архив)
 
(не показано 19 промежуточных версий 2 участников)
Строка 6: Строка 6:
 
Для того, чтобы скачать Passbook архив необходимо сделать следующее:
 
Для того, чтобы скачать Passbook архив необходимо сделать следующее:
  
== 1.Настроить сертификат для PassBook ==
+
== Настроить сертификат для PassBook ==
  
 
Для этого необходимо зайти в раздел настроек "Администрирование - Реквизиты подключения"
 
Для этого необходимо зайти в раздел настроек "Администрирование - Реквизиты подключения"
  
 
Далее загружаем сертификат в поле “Сертификат для подписи PassBook”
 
Далее загружаем сертификат в поле “Сертификат для подписи PassBook”
 +
 +
Данный сертификат предоставляет компания APPLE
  
 
[[Файл:Passbook.jpg]]
 
[[Файл:Passbook.jpg]]
  
 +
== Создать запрос  UpdateBook==
 +
Создать запрос на обновление заказа UpdateBook с параметрами UpdateOrder = false и  UpdatePaymentTransactions = false.
  
== 2. Создать запрос  UpdateBook==
+
Пример запроса
Создать запрос UpdateBook с параметрами UpdateOrder = false и  UpdatePaymentTransactions = false.
+
[[Дополнительные_запросы_АПИ_авиабилетов]]
Пример запроса :[[http://support.nemo.travel/ru/%D0%94%D0%BE%D0%BF%D0%BE%D0%BB%D0%BD%D0%B8%D1%82%D0%B5%D0%BB%D1%8C%D0%BD%D1%8B%D0%B5_%D0%B7%D0%B0%D0%BF%D1%80%D0%BE%D1%81%D1%8B_%D0%90%D0%9F%D0%98_%D0%B0%D0%B2%D0%B8%D0%B0%D0%B1%D0%B8%D0%BB%D0%B5%D1%82%D0%BE%D0%B2#.D0.97.D0.B0.D0.BF.D1.80.D0.BE.D1.81_.D0.BD.D0.B0_.D0.BE.D0.B1.D0.BD.D0.BE.D0.B2.D0.BB.D0.B5.D0.BD.D0.B8.D0.B5_.D0.B7.D0.B0.D0.BA.D0.B0.D0.B7.D0.B0]]
 
  
 +
==Получить специальный секретный код==
  
==3.Получить специальный секретный код==
 
 
В ответе UpdateBook получить специальный секретный код в разделе: Response->OneTimeBookingCode
 
В ответе UpdateBook получить специальный секретный код в разделе: Response->OneTimeBookingCode
  
==4. Скачать  passbook архив==
+
==Скачать  passbook архив==
  необходимо по  url адресу:
+
 
https://ВашДомен/apple__get_pass&booking_id=BOOKING_ID&one_time_booking_code=ONE_TIME_BOOKING_CODE
+
Passbook архив необходим пассажиру, чтобы можно было скачать в устройство информацию о заказе
Где:
+
Для этого необходимо перейти по  url адресу:
BOOKING_ID это номер заказа  
+
                                                                                                                                                                                       
ONE_TIME_BOOKING_CODE это одноразовый пароль, полученный в предыдущем шаге.
+
WSDL: https://CLIENT_DOMAIN/apple__get_pass&booking_id=BOOKING_ID&one_time_booking_code=ONE_TIME_BOOKING_CODE
 +
 
 +
* BOOKING_ID это номер заказа  
 +
* ONE_TIME_BOOKING_CODE это одноразовый пароль, полученный в предыдущем шаге.  
 +
После обновления заказа, секретный одноразовый код, который содержится в ссылке на оплату - меняется. Потому необходимо либо перед переходом на оплату перезапрашивать новую ссылку с правильным кодом, либо не обновляете заказ до перехода на оплату
  
 
----
 
----
  
 
Важно! Значение OneTimeBookingCode является одноразовым. При неудачной загрузке, необходимо заново сгенерировать пароль.
 
Важно! Значение OneTimeBookingCode является одноразовым. При неудачной загрузке, необходимо заново сгенерировать пароль.
 +
 +
== См. также ==
 +
* [[Агентский_АПИ]]
 +
* [[Дополнительные_запросы_АПИ_авиабилетов]]
 +
 +
[[Category:Термины]]

Текущая версия на 20:45, 6 января 2016

Passbook — это часть операционной системы iPhone. Passbook позволяет хранить в одном месте электронные карточки: подтверждение всех важных покупок в интернете и броней, авиабилеты или билеты в кино, а также купоны на скидки и дисконтные карты, отображая на экране телефона необходимую клиенту информацию об услуге, например: размер скидки, адреса магазинов, фото, срок действия и т.п., и штрих-код с зашифрованной информацией, той же самой, которую сейчас несут в себе пластиковые карточки. [1]


Для того, чтобы скачать Passbook архив необходимо сделать следующее:

Настроить сертификат для PassBook

Для этого необходимо зайти в раздел настроек "Администрирование - Реквизиты подключения"

Далее загружаем сертификат в поле “Сертификат для подписи PassBook”

Данный сертификат предоставляет компания APPLE

Passbook.jpg

Создать запрос UpdateBook

Создать запрос на обновление заказа UpdateBook с параметрами UpdateOrder = false и UpdatePaymentTransactions = false.

Пример запроса Дополнительные_запросы_АПИ_авиабилетов

Получить специальный секретный код

В ответе UpdateBook получить специальный секретный код в разделе: Response->OneTimeBookingCode

Скачать passbook архив

Passbook архив необходим пассажиру, чтобы можно было скачать в устройство информацию о заказе Для этого необходимо перейти по url адресу:

WSDL: https://CLIENT_DOMAIN/apple__get_pass&booking_id=BOOKING_ID&one_time_booking_code=ONE_TIME_BOOKING_CODE

  • BOOKING_ID это номер заказа
  • ONE_TIME_BOOKING_CODE это одноразовый пароль, полученный в предыдущем шаге.

После обновления заказа, секретный одноразовый код, который содержится в ссылке на оплату - меняется. Потому необходимо либо перед переходом на оплату перезапрашивать новую ссылку с правильным кодом, либо не обновляете заказ до перехода на оплату


Важно! Значение OneTimeBookingCode является одноразовым. При неудачной загрузке, необходимо заново сгенерировать пароль.

См. также